SERVICE AND CARE

The chassis may be cleaned with a soft towel and Windex® or a similar window cleaner. Spray
it on the cleaning cloth to moisten it, not on the component. Do not use solvents or harsh
chemicals to clean the preamplifier. They may remove the labels from the chassis. The
frequency and need of cleaning will be governed by operating environmental conditions. Avoid
letting the component become dusty or wet. A 'feather duster' type cleaner will also work well
for cleaning the component.

Tube Replacement

If it becomes necessary to replace the tubes in the preamp the same brand should be used. A
new tube kit is available from Cary Audio Design. Although tube life varies depending on the
nature and degree of use, under normal operating condition for home use, the tubes in the SLP
98 should last several years and may last much longer.

WARNINGS
MAKE NO ATTEMPT TO PUT THE SLP 98 IN SERVICE OUTSIDE OF THE CABINET –
CONTACT WITH HIGH VOLTAGES FOUND IN THE UNIT CAN BE FATAL.
COMPLETELY REMOVE AC POWER PLUG FROM THE WALL AND ALLOW 30
MINUTES FOR THE HIGH VOLTAGE CAPACITORS TO DISCHARGE THROUGH
BLEEDER RESISTORS BEFORE ATTEMPTING TO CHANGE TUBES OR CLEAN THE
INSIDE TO THE PREAMPLIFIER.
CAUTIONS
NEVER REMOVE / INSERT AC PLUG WHEN THE UNIT IS ON OR THE AC POWER
SWITCH IS IN THE ON POSITION. OBSTRUCTION OF THE TOP PORTION OF THE
COMPONENT WILL RESULT IN TUBES OVERHEATING.
